A Study on Type of Accidental Injury in Urban Childhood
|
|
|
|
Abstract
|
|
|
The nature of 4,142 accidental injury occaured from 22,434 urban childhood was studied and the following results were obtained.
1. The most frequent type of injury was contusion(23. 3%) and Abrasion, Burn Fracture, Laceration were leading types of childhood injury. Contusion increased after Pre-School age instead of Burn which was one of three major injury during Pre-School childhood. Perforation, Contusion, Dislocation, and Fracture were more frequently happen for Boys whereas Burn, poisoning and Concussion for Girls.
2. Thirty-eight point three percent of total injury were attended by Doctor. Confusion, Perforation, Poisoning and Contusion were injuries treated by doctors relatively high proportionately whereas Burn was low.
